Stevens-Johnson syndrome and Toxic Epidermal Necrolysis syndrome are life-threatening reactions that can result in death. Complications include permanent blindness, dry-eye syndrome, lung damage, photophobia, asthma, chronic obstructive pulmonary disease, permanent loss of nail beds, scarring of mucous membranes, arthritis, and chronic fatigue syndrome. Many patients' pores scar shut, causing them to retain heat.

In 1886, William Bates reported on the discovery of a substance produced by the adrenal gland that turned out to be epinephrine (adrenaline). In 1904, this drug was first artificially synthesized by Friedrich Stolz.

The lipid bilayer is made of phospholipids. They are arranged in a double layer because one of their ends is attracted to water while the other is repelled by water.

Prostaglandins were first isolated from human semen in Sweden in the 1930s. They were so named because the researcher thought that they came from the prostate gland. In fact, prostaglandins exist and are synthesized in almost every cell of the body.
